For the RTX 3060 Ti, it's recommended to have a power supply unit (PSU) of at least 600 watts. This ensures that your system runs smoothly and can handle the power demands of the graphics card, even under heavy loads. Consider a PSU with an 80 Plus rating for better efficiency and reliability. Additionally, make sure that your PSU has the necessary PCIe power connectors to support the RTX 3060 Ti. This setup will help to optimize performance and prevent potential power issues.
